Eight teams have qualified so far for the FIFA World Cup knockout stages.
Uruguay will meet Colombia in one of the elimination matches at 8am Sunday while Brazil takes on Chile at 4am.
On Monday at 4am the Netherlands will meet Mexico at 4am followed by Greece and Costa Rica at 8am.
16 teams will be part of the eliminations where the eight winners will go through to the quarterfinals.
Tomorrow at 4am Nigeria face Argentina, Bosnia Herzegovina will take on Iran and at 8am Honduras face Switzerland while Ecuador meets France.
Looking at today’s results Greece defeated Ivory Coast 2-1, Colombia beat Japan 4-1 while England drew nil-all with Costa Rica.
Meanwhile Uruguay's star striker Luis Suarez has been accused of biting a player for the third time in his career after an incident with Giorgio Chiellini following their 1-0 win over Italy this morning.
